Revolutionen och evolution Software Testing

Vad det innebär för företag och programvara Test Professionals

exponentiell tillväxt är inget nytt i IT-branschen. Den relativt korta historia IT är utbredd med revolution. Tänk mikrochip, superdatorer, Power PC chips, persondatorn, World Wide Web, artificiell intelligens och så vidare. Alla har haft omvälvande effekter på människor och företag. Omdömen

Och under det senaste årtiondet Software Testing tjänsten utvecklas till en kritisk komponent för företag att lyckas och en möjlighet för de bästa och smartaste att mejsla ut spännande och givande karriärer. Omdömen

det gamla paradigmet.
Det var inte så många år sedan att programvara testare var en mindre aktör i mjukvaruutveckling processen. I själva verket, 20-tal år sedan, det var inte ens vara en disciplin i sin egen rätt. Den viktiga roll mjukvarutestning och programvara testare var att fånga buggar i utvecklare och' kod, en process huvudsakligen utförs manuellt.

Själva processen var rutin och repetitiva, ingenting mer än att följa och upprepa en uppsättning skriftliga anvisningar formulerade av tillämpningen &'en; s krav. Med betoning på mått och mallar, var det en icke-intellektuellt förhållningssätt till affärsprocessen. I IT &'; s barndom var det ofta utvecklaren själv som tog ansvar för felsökning sin egen kod. För att undvika denna uppenbara intressekonflikter, senare blev det en vanlig metod för att separera testfasen från utvecklingsfasen. Detta innebar ofta att tilldela denna uppgift till yngre medlemmar av IT-personal, ett försök att minska kostnaderna och fördela den största delen av systemets budget till utveckling. Omdömen

I en flera faser systemutveckling livscykel, testning förvisades en tidslucka strax före programvaruproduktlansering. Anses mindre viktig än de konstruktions- och utvecklingsfaserna av projektet, testfasen var ofta utsatt för schemaläggning kramar mot slutet av projektet. Som ett resultat, testare ofta ansvarig för kvalitetsfrågor som dykt upp efter produktlansering. Omdömen

Den nya paradigmet.
Enorma tillväxten av Internet har och allt omvandla inför verksamheten. Och dess uppkomst har skapat nya spännande möjligheter och potential för företagens tillväxt och lönsamhet. I denna internet ålder, har webbaserade applikationer blir hur kunderna, både inom och utanför organisationen, interagera med näringslivet Omdömen

Samtidigt, detta &';.-Konsumenter och' av företagets program utsätter kompetens och konkurrensfördelar i din verksamhet. Inte längre främst internt driva verksamheten, företagsamhet program blir alltmer konsumentdriven med dramatisk effekt för företag över vitt skilda branscher såsom finans, hälsovård, utbildning, media och detaljhandel. Omdömen

Det är dock inte denna snabba utveckling utan dess fallgropar. För företag långsamt att anamma dessa förändringar och ta itu med dessa komplikationer, kan konsekvenserna av att hamna på efterkälken denna programvara revolution vara ödesdigra Omdömen

Roll Software Testing i New Paradigm
Med dagens och'.. S betoning på konsumentstyrda program och direkt interaktion mellan konsumenter och företag, har det blivit nödvändigt att dessa program fungerar felfritt. För att säkerställa optimal tillämpning beteende, betydelsen av mjukvarutestning tjänster har kraftigt förhöjda i betydelse som en mycket viktig del av mjukvaruutveckling processen. Inte längre en eftertanke, har mjukvarukvalitetstestning blivit en viktig integrerad del av systemet livscykel Omdömen

Som sådan, det främsta målet med mjukvarutestning företag i dag och'. Är mjukvarumiljö mycket bredare. Inte längre en begränsad, repetitiv uppgift har testning av programvara blivit en omfattande disciplin kräver en förståelse som omfattar hela mjukvarusystem; en omfattande process att avslöja brister, som syftar till att förbättra kvaliteten på koden och ge en stödjande återkopplingsanordning till byggherren. Längre än att bara försäkra din ansökan gör vad den är tänkt att göra, måste mjukvarutestning också försäkra ansökan inte gör vad den inte är tänkt att göra Omdömen

Det &';. SA process som går långt utöver det traditionella och separat SDLC fas, anklagad för felsökning kod och får integreras i varje fas av utvecklingen livscykel. Med andra ord, bör vi testar analysen bör vi testa design, vi bör testa utvecklingen. Omdömen

utmaningar det nya paradigmet.
Med en sådan utökad roll och ökad betydelse tilldelas mjukvaruutveckling process, kom stora utmaningar. Såsom angivits ovan, mer än en ren &'; felsökning &'; aktivitet, har testning tjänster blivit en kvalitetssäkring och riskhantering aktivitet. Den traditionella bugg fynd testare snabbt vända föråldrade. I dess ställe har vuxit fram behovet av programvara testingenjörer rustade att ta på dessa utökade ansvarsområden. Idag &'; s programvara testare kräver breda kunskaper och färdigheter. De måste förvärva förmågan att planera, designa och köra effektiva tester för att avslöja frågor som rör uppgifternas kvalitet och inkonsekvens, säkerhet, slutanvändarens affärsflödet förväntningar och applikationsprestanda.

En annan konsekvens av konsumentdriven applikation utveckling är den ökande komplexiteten och spridning av teknik och programvara för produktutveckling som utgör sina egna utmaningar för testning av programvara.

Till exempel anser idag och' s mobil applikation utveckling Man kan föreställa komplexiteten i praktiken testa sådana tillämpningar som korsar en myriad av användar tekniska miljöer och platser. Tänk på en testmatris som sträcker sig över flera operativsystem, mobila webbläsare, placering och bärare, egna märken och modeller. It &'; s bara en av ett ökande antal IT-applikationer som involverar mer komplexa affärsprocesser med ytterligare förvecklingar och inter-connectiveness. Du kan föreställa kvalitetssäkrings utmaningar som finns för organisationer som har till uppgift att testa sådana omfångsrika scenarier. Omdömen

Att ta itu med Software Testing Challenge
Problemet är att det inte finns tillräckligt med kvalificerade ingenjörer för att tillgodose den växande efterfrågan. Enligt forskning av Gartner, Inc., det finns idag en hög andel testare för utvecklare inom icke-mjukvaruföretag, på mellan 1: 3 i bästa fall, till 1: 5. Med tanke på att anslagen till den totala kostnaden applikationsutveckling ägnas åt tester förväntas öka betydligt, är resultatet en stor diskrepans mellan utbud och efterfrågan för programvara testare, med efterföljande flaskhalsar i mjukvaruutveckling processen.

Enligt en rapport från mikrofokus gruppen, prov-as-a-service beräknas öka med mer än 33% per år till och med 2013. I själva verket, denna grupp har benämnt denna massiva förändring i tillväxten av programvara testning som &'; IT &'; s Invisible Giant &' ;. Omdömen

Så, vad och 'en; s lösningen för ditt företag? I grund och botten har du tre alternativ. One kan du fortsätta att använda den gamla tester paradigm. Visst är detta din minst kostsamma lösningen … i dollar.
Men som vi tidigare har detaljerade den verkliga kostnaden för att inte inse vikten av och omfamna de förändringar havet som äger rum i mjukvaruindustrin kan leda till förödande konsekvenser på lång sikt för din verksamhet.

En andra alternativ innebär omskolning din nuvarande testa personal och /eller rekrytera testingenjörer utbildats i nya tester disciplin. Inlärningskurvan här kan vara måttlig till branta beroende på ditt företags behov och upplevelsen av din personal. Åtminstone det ger dig att känna igen ändringarna och påbörja processen med att integrera dina testare med givarsamfundet. Få dem inbjudna till viktiga möten, främja över gruppsamarbete och få verkställande köpa in för testteam och' s ansträngningar. Från design till genomförande dina testare bör bli verkliga partner, bidra med kunskap, förslag och kunskaper under hela applikationsutveckling livscykel. Omdömen

Tredje part Solution. Idéer för företag vars verksamhet är starkt beroende av webbaserade system till möta kundernas behov och växa vinster, dock möjligheter förlorade ikapp till den nya tester paradigm kan inte upprätthållas tillräckligt länge.

Den goda nyheten är att den ökande betydelsen och komplexiteten i vårt mjukvarutestning landskapet har gett upphov till flera nya företag som är specialiserade inom kvalitetssäkring och test av mjukvara teknik.

Det bästa av dessa organisationer rekrytera och utbilda högt motiverade och välutbildade studenter och yrkesverksamma inom testspektrumet. Inom dessa organisationer är specialister inom ett eller flera av de olika mjukvarutestning discipliner. Så kallade horisontella specialister är experter på att använda automatiserade verktyg, processer och metoder som behövs för att utföra en effektiv och ändamålsenlig funktionella tester, prestandatester, säkerhet testning, användbarhetstest, globalisering och internalisering testning. Vertikala specialister har särskild kunskap om produkter och protokoll som används inom de olika och populära specialiserade områden, såsom mobil /trådlöst testning, nätverk /datakommunikation testning, VOIP testning, och andra. Många av dessa specialister har även fördjupad kunskap om specifika branscher, såsom bank och finans, utbildning, detaljhandel och hälsovård. Omdömen

Den professionella softwareingenjör är också aktuell på trender och tekniker som driver växande och ständigt utvecklas krav i den moderna IT-landskapet. Trender som följande redovisas och omfamnade i företag som specialiserat sig på oberoende testtjänster:

Agile Development - Ett ökande populär och relativt nytt program utvecklingsmetodik, betonar Agile Development konsekvent testning över hela systemutvecklings livscykel . En gratis system Test Driven Development (TDD) är en utvecklingsprocess programvara speciellt uppbyggd kring testprocessen. It &'; s metod som innebär snabbare och frekvent testning, en iterativ testprocessen och skapa testscenarion förskott som blir grunden för produktutvecklingen. Agile ger programvara testare närmare till ansökan och är utformad för att fånga fel, och injicera produktkvalitet tidigt och konsekvent genom hela utvecklingsprocessen livscykel. Omdömen

Testa i moln En annan trend, som växer i popularitet, ger Cloud on demand tester med möjlighet att snabbt replikera ansökan testmiljöer offsite. Detta alternativ till &'; hyra &'; lämplig infrastruktur test och automatiserade testverktyg, ger även mindre företag kapacitet att utföra komplexa och sofistikerade tester utan betungande kostnad och investeringar i infrastruktur och verktygsinköp. I själva verket lovar Cloud computing en exponentiell ökning i efterfrågan på prestanda och lasttesttjänster, som annars kan vara en mycket dyr rad för produktbolag. Omdömen

Utrustad med de resurser och förmåga att ta en myriad av kvalitetssäkring och testa projekt från början till slut, har sådana QA organisationer blivit viktiga vapen för många företag som vill förbättra sin produktkvalitet effektivt, i tid och kostnadseffektivt. Omdömen

Nya möjligheter för IT Professional. hotell med stora utmaningar kommer stora möjligheter. För dagens och' s IT-tekniker och för dem som strävar efter en karriär inom IT och erbjuder programvara testteknik löftet om en spännande, utmanande och givande försörjning i testdesign och teknikområde Omdömen

tillväxt och expansion. av internet, framstegen inom teknik har gett upphov till, och dess efterfrågan från och värde för dagens och' s verksamheter, kräver ljus, kunniga, anpassningsbar, självsäker, motiverade och entusiastiska personal för att möta dessa nya utmaningar och hålla jämna steg med förändringen. De kunna möta dessa utmaningar kommer att ha gott om och givande möjligheter för progressiv karriär tillväxt, med en mängd potentiella roller och ansvarsområden Omdömen

Inte längre mindre prestigefyllda för Software Developer &';. Roll, ökade ansvar och kompetens kraven i Software Test Engineer har gjort dem jämbördiga partner i IT-utvecklingsprocessen både belöningar och erkännande Omdömen  ..

fortsatt utbildning

  1. Blog Success - Tips Gör din blogg Stand Out
  2. MacKeeper Deal och även robust. Mac Tidy utöver risk free
  3. Vikten omfattar Oracle Qualification Tests
  4. Få din Flebotomi Certifiering Online
  5. Några stora fördelarna med Off-site Sharepoint Owners
  6. Inlärning av termin skriftligen genom internet och guides
  7. Låt din dröm handlag Utmost Roof
  8. Inte förvärva Långvarig Warranties
  9. Mycket effektivt team som ger bästa resumes
  10. Microsoft Dynamics AX 2009 Installation och konfiguration: MB6-820
  11. Logos Administration tillsammans med MBA kurser On-line
  12. Tre skäl som du bör välja för Online Reiki Master Certifiering Programs
  13. 3 anledningar till varför du behöver för att göra din Masterprogram Online
  14. Hantering Din sociala webbplatser Profiler Like a Yrke Seeker
  15. Sälja din konstverk Online - Kund Testimonials
  16. Fyra metoder för att förbättra din dator Speed
  17. Ortho-BionomyR: Långsam Dancing in the Still Point
  18. University om Phoenix, az Certifierad På internet School
  19. Vad ska man Berätta Children
  20. Online Disputation Service